**A Legacy of Innovation and Inspiration**

 

Since their formation in 1996, Coldplay has transformed the landscape of alternative and pop music, blending heartfelt lyrics, innovative soundscapes, and captivating performances. With hits like “Yellow,” “Viva La Vida,” “Paradise,” and “A Sky Full of Stars,” the band has garnered a global fanbase and numerous awards, including multiple Grammys, Brit Awards, and an Academy Award.

 

Throughout their career, Coldplay has been known for their commitment to musical experimentation and their ability to evolve with the times. From their early guitar-driven anthems to their later electronic and orchestral collaborations, Coldplay has continually pushed artistic boundaries. Their influence extends beyond music, inspiring activism and social causes, including environmental sustainability and human rights.
